Merged in CLIP-1866-fix-multiple-default-releases (pull request #158)

CLIP-1866: Add plain version tag to only one variant of jdk

Approved-by: Eugene Ivantsov
This commit is contained in:
Yifei Zhang 2024-04-16 06:35:32 +00:00
commit a309f75347
2 changed files with 1290 additions and 96 deletions

File diff suppressed because it is too large Load Diff

View File

@ -8,17 +8,35 @@ REPOS = ['atlassian/confluence']
images = {
'Confluence': {
11: {
"11-default": {
'start_version': '7.19',
'end_version': '9.0',
'end_version': '8.3',
'default_release': True,
'base_image': 'eclipse-temurin:11',
'tag_suffixes': ['jdk11','ubuntu-jdk11'],
'dockerfile': 'Dockerfile',
'docker_repos': REPOS,
},
11: {
'start_version': '8.3',
'end_version': '9.0',
'default_release': False,
'base_image': 'eclipse-temurin:11',
'tag_suffixes': ['jdk11','ubuntu-jdk11'],
'dockerfile': 'Dockerfile',
'docker_repos': REPOS,
},
17: {
'start_version': '8.0',
'end_version': '8.3',
'default_release': False,
'base_image': 'eclipse-temurin:17',
'tag_suffixes': ['jdk17','ubuntu-jdk17'],
'dockerfile': 'Dockerfile',
'docker_repos': REPOS,
},
"17-default": {
'start_version': '8.3',
'default_release': True,
'base_image': 'eclipse-temurin:17',
'tag_suffixes': ['jdk17','ubuntu-jdk17'],
@ -27,7 +45,7 @@ images = {
},
"17-ubi": {
'start_version': '8.5.6',
'default_release': True,
'default_release': False,
'base_image': 'registry.access.redhat.com/ubi9/openjdk-17',
'tag_suffixes': ['ubi9','ubi9-jdk17'],
'dockerfile': 'Dockerfile.ubi',